What affects the price

When you are looking at a new HVAC setup, the final number depends on a few moving parts. The physical size of your home and the necessary ductwork adjustments play a huge role. We also look at the efficiency ratings of the unit; higher efficiency models often cost more upfront but can change your monthly utility bills. Other factors include the type of fuel your home uses, specific brand preferences, and any modifications needed to your existing electrical system. It is best to look at these as investments in your comfort.

About this service

The price you pay for AC installation is largely dictated by the unit's cooling capacity, measured in tons, and the difficulty of the installation location. Choosing a model with higher energy efficiency often costs more upfront but can help lower monthly utility expenses over time.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.
